Causes of Bike Accidents

Bicycle accidents typically occur because the driver in a vehicle isn't paying attention or is driving recklessly.

Common causes of bicycle accidents include:

  • Reckless driving
  • Driving under the influence
  • Texting while driving
  • Using a cell phone while driving
  • Changing the radio
  • Running a red light or stop sign
  • Speeding
  • Failing to yield
  • Making an illegal turn

All of these actions are considered negligence. Under Florida personal injury law, when an accident is caused by the negligence or reckless actions of another person, that person is liable for paying damages to the victims.

Taking Legal Action Following Your Bicycle Accident

If you have suffered an injury in a bicycle accident caused by a negligent driver, we can help you take legal action. As a victim, you have rights that entitle you to compensation for your pain and suffering, mental distress, lost wages, and medical bills.

You are also entitled to have your bike replaced. If you had specialized parts or custom additions on your bike, those can be replaced as well.
